North Road, London

img-fluid w-100
img-fluid w-100
img-fluid w-100
img-fluid w-100
img-fluid w-100
img-fluid w-100
img-fluid w-100
img-fluid w-100
img-fluid w-100
img-fluid w-100
img-fluid w-100
img-fluid w-100
img-fluid w-100
img-fluid w-100
img-fluid w-100
img-fluid w-100

North Road, London

  • North Road, London, N7
  • Let

£1849 pcm

  • img 1
  • img 1

Description

Stunning 1-bedroom flat!

Amenities

What this place offer

  • Kitchen
  • Bath
Book A Valuation
Book A Valuation
Request your Free,
No-Commitment Valuation Now!